Lozi, not just any Zambian interpreter. Lozi is a Sotho-Tswana language, a different branch of Bantu from Bemba or Nyanja, so a Bemba or Nyanja interpreter cannot stand in for a Lozi one. Lozi is one of Zambia's seven official regional languages, used in early primary schooling and on ZNBC radio, and spoken by about six percent of Zambians, mostly in Western Province; in Namibia, Lozi is a recognised national language of the Zambezi Region. Most Lozi speakers of working age also speak English and will not need a Lozi interpreter; an elderly parent, or a witness describing life in a Zambezi floodplain village, will. No state runs a court certification exam in Lozi, so courts use a qualified Lozi interpreter, usually by phone or video, and Lozi is the kind of rare language courts come to us for. Orange is a city within Orange County. California unified its trial courts in 1998, so there is no municipal court: all matters go to the Superior Court of California, County of Orange. The Lamoreaux Justice Center, in the city of Orange, hears juvenile, family law and domestic violence cases, while criminal, civil and small claims matters are heard at the Central Justice Center in Santa Ana.

Lozi to English Translation Services in Orange

Certified Lozi to English translation is needed for the supporting papers rather than the certificate, since Zambia and Namibia issue civil records in English. Our Lozi translators render the affidavit, the headman's or church letter and the traditional marriage statement, and sign a Certificate of Translation Accuracy prepared to meet USCIS requirements.

Lozi paperwork is in English. A Lozi family from Zambia's Western Province holds a birth certificate issued under the Births and Deaths Registration Act by the Department of National Registration, Passport and Citizenship at the Ministry of Home Affairs; a Lozi family from Namibia's Zambezi Region holds Namibian records, also in English. Neither country issues civil documents in Lozi, so a Lozi birth certificate as such does not exist. What reaches a Lozi translator is the affidavit, the letter from a village headman or church, the traditional marriage statement, and the Lozi names and villages inside an English record. The snag is a Lozi name spelled one way by a registrar in Western Province and another way by the passport office; a translator who quietly standardises the two hands USCIS a mismatch. We match the passport and note the variant.

About the Lozi Language

Lozi is a Bantu language spoken by around 500,000 people in western Zambia (Western Province / Barotseland), with smaller communities in Namibia, Botswana, and Zimbabwe. The US Lozi-speaking community is essentially non-existent; Zambian civil documents are typically in English and routed accordingly.

Will a Bemba or Nyanja interpreter do for a Lozi speaker?

No. Lozi is a Sotho-Tswana language, a different branch of Bantu from Bemba or Nyanja. We assign a Lozi interpreter, usually by phone or video because in-person Lozi interpreters are scarce in the United States. No state certifies court interpreters in Lozi.
